About the Role
The Baltimore Banner is seeking a versatile, ambitious sports reporter to cover Baltimore-area sports with depth, creativity, and rigor. From the Orioles’ clubhouse to boxing gyms, horse tracks, and college arenas, you will produce stories that inform, entertain, and resonate with readers—while helping grow our subscriber base.

This is a role for a journalist who can break news with authority, craft deeply reported profiles and enterprise pieces, and combine storytelling with data-driven insights. You’ll cover the business of sports, explore cultural and community impact, and help readers understand both the game and the world around it.

What You’Ll Do

  • Break significant sports news, from Orioles headlines to high-profile local sports events.
  • Serve as the backup Orioles reporter, traveling to ~35% of away games and attending ~60% of home games (adjusted based on breaking news and story potential).
  • Produce compelling features, profiles, and enterprise pieces that reveal the “why” behind the action.
  • Monitor the local sports scene, uncovering stories our readers didn’t know they wanted. Stay current on news surrounding local stars like Angel Reese and Gervonta Davis to produce unique coverage.
  • Collaborate with The Banner’s engagement and data teams to maximize audience reach and impact across platforms.
  • Partner with editors and reporters across coverage areas where sports intersect business, culture, and community.
  • Engage audiences via video, podcasts, and social media to build a vibrant, interactive connection with readers.
